Scope and contentRCAP 21 contains the proceedings of the Royal Commission on Aboriginal Peoples sitting at Wahpeton, Saskatchewan on May 26, 1992. Included are presentations from various members of the Wahpeton Dakota First Nation on a range of subjects of interest to the community. Each presentation can be viewed individually on this site.
